As well as our 170th year anniversary celebrations, we also celebrate the 30 years service of Mrs Joyce Maciver , who has faithfully served the Church as Session Clerk as well as many other roles with the Church . Joyce was presented with a long service certificate by the Moderator of the General Assembly of The Church of Scotland , the Rt. Revd Gordon Kennedy along with our own minister Rev Dr. Peter Donald.

Thank you Joyce for all you do and with a smile!

JOINT ECUMENICAL PENTECOST SUNDAY SERVICE AT CORPUS CHRISTI

Next Sunday, 24 May 2026 will be Pentecost Sunday, the day we remember the coming of the Holy Spirit on the disciples and the birth of the church.
To celebrate this very important occasion, a special joint service of praise and thanksgiving with the congregation of Corpus Christi, Calderbank will be held in Corpus Christi Church at 7pm. All are welcome !

‼️Save the dates ‼️

This year our Church building is 170 years old and to mark this anniversary we are holding a garden party on Saturday 6th June from 1pm -3pm , with many activities planned for the day .

On Sunday 7th June at 10:30am a special service to mark 170 years will take place .

Summer Holiday Club
Will take place from Monday 20th - Thursday 23rd July from 10am - 12 noon each day. All primary school aged children are welcome - registration details to follow .
